TNT announced today that it has picked up British sci-fi drama The Lazarus Project for a second season. Coming two weeks before its June 4 premiere, the news is no surprise, as the show has already been renewed for Season 2 by original network Sky Max in the UK.
The series follows a man named George, who is the latest recruit to a secret organization that has harnessed the ability to turn back time whenever the world is at the brink of extinction. George and his colleagues are a select group of people with the ability to remember the events that are undone when time goes back. After a freak accident harms someone close to George, he is not allowed to turn back time to undo it. He must decide to either stay loyal or go rogue and deal with the consequences.
The Lazarus Project will air its second season in 2024.
